Samsung has released many Android 13 beta upgrades. Galaxy S21 and S22 feature Samsung One UI 5.0 beta. The current version of One UI contains hundreds of new and better functionality, but the UI design hasn’t changed. Animations and transitions need work.
Yes, it’s a beta update and will contain bugs. The second beta of One UI 5.0 has gotten worse. One UI 4.1.1 and the first 5.0 beta version have smoother animations. Ice Universe (@UniverseIce) posted slow-motion videos comparing One UI 5.0’s animation to older versions of One UI, OPPO’s ColorOS 13, Xiaomi’s MIUI 13, and Vivo’s OriginOS.

The One UI 5.0 design has leaked. New features, better animations, and more are coming.
The next One UI 5.0 will be based on Android 13. The later OS version is in preview mode for some non-Samsung smartphones and might preview One UI 5.0 features.
Android 13 moves settings and power shortcuts to the Quick Settings menu. Google may increase Material You customization.
One UI 5.0 may borrow from Android 13, but Google’s software already shows hints of borrowing from prior versions. Android 13 preview versions add a flashlight brightness setting.
